Here’s a daiquiri that’s all about autumn and has the ingredients of a pumpkin pie, including the crust and whipped cream.
This spiked pumpkin pie has to be served with a straw because no forks or spoons are allowed. And the good news is that you can eat the crust with your fingers because it’s in the form of a cute jack-o’-lantern cookie.
This daiquiri looks and tastes like fall but has just a touch of lime to it from the lemon-lime soda.
And what’s a pie without crust? This pumpkin pie daiquiri comes with its own crust and whipped cream in the form of a festive garnish.
Pumpkin pie daiquiri with edible jack-o’-lantern garnish recipe
Serves 2
Prep time: 15 minutes | Cook time: 10 minutes | Inactive time: 10 minutes | Total time: 35 minutes
Ingredients:
- 1/4 cup canned pumpkin puree
- 3 tablespoons sweetened condensed milk
- 1 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
- 1 cup lemon-lime soda (diet or regular)
- 3 ounces gold rum
- 2 cups ice cubes
- Premade pie dough, cut into six 2-1/4-inch circles, for garnish (optional)
- 1 egg yolk, beaten (egg wash for pie dough, optional for garnish)
- 2 tablespoons Cool Whip topping, for garnish (optional)
- 1/8 teaspoon ground cinnamon, for garnish
Directions:
- Heat the oven to 350 degrees F.
- For 2 of the circular pie dough shapes, cut out eyes, a nose and a mouth to make a jack-o’-lantern.
- For 2 of the other circular pie dough shapes, roll in a loose, tubular shape like a straw (this will hold the jack-o’-lantern in place inside the daiquiri).
- On a small cookie sheet, lay all the pie crust shapes. With a food brush or the back of a spoon, brush egg yolk on top of just the jack-o’-lanterns.
- Bake all the pie crust shapes until they turn a golden color (about 5 to 7 minutes for the circular shapes; the tubular shapes may take 2 to 3 minutes longer). Remove from the oven, and set aside to cool.
- Add Cool Whip to each of the plain circular pie crusts, and then sprinkle a pinch of cinnamon on top of the Cool Whip. Then gently put 1 of the jack-o’-lanterns on top of the Cool Whip to form a sandwich. Set aside.
- To a blender, add the pumpkin, sweetened condensed milk, pumpkin pie spice, soda and ice. Blend on the smoothie setting.
- After pouring the daiquiri into each glass, lay the tubular pie crust shape inside the glass, up against 1 of the sides. It should stick out of the drink slightly. Add to the top edge of the pie crust a small dollop of Cool Whip. Lay the jack-o’-lantern flat on top of the dollop of Cool Whip, add a couple of pinches of cinnamon on top of the daiquiri, and serve.
